CMS readies provider IDs

BALTIMORE - CMS last month announced the adoption of the National Provider Identifier (NPI) for all health care providers to use in filing and processing health care claims and other transactions. The NPI is a new number that will be issued through the National Provider System, which currently is being developed by CMS. A health care provider will be assigned only one NPI, which will enable them to use only one identifier in all standard transactions. CMS said it hopes the NPI will reduce costs and improve efficiency in the nation's health care system by eliminating the need for health care providers to maintain, keep track of, and use multiple identification numbers assigned by the various health plans they bill. All health care providers, whether or not they are covered under HIPAA, will be eligible to receive an NPI, which has a compliance date of May 23, 2007.
